X为了获得更好的用户体验,请使用火狐、谷歌、360浏览器极速模式或IE8及以上版本的浏览器
关于我们
欢迎来到科易网(仲恺)技术转移协同创新平台,请 登录 | 注册
尊敬的 , 欢迎光临!  [会员中心]  [退出登录]
成果 专家 院校 需求
当前位置: 首页 >  科技成果  > 详细页

[01190691]基于Midas GTS的快速有限差分法网格生成原件V1.0

交易价格: 面议

所属行业: 软件

类型: 非专利

交易方式: 资料待完善

联系人:

所在地:

服务承诺
产权明晰
资料保密
对所交付的所有资料进行保密
如实描述
|
收藏
|

技术详细介绍

1. 课题的研究来源与背景 工程力学数值分析是隧道与地下工程研究领域的主要研究手段。在数值分析中,一个重要的步骤和先决条件是形成合理的离散网格模型。所谓合理的网格模型,即要求数值网格满足以下条件:(1)尽可能少的节点数与单元数;(2)合理的网格疏密分布;(3)合理的单元几何形状。显然,对于面向实际工程的数值网格模型,要满足以上三个条件,除了数值建模人员需要有足够的网格划分经验和技巧外,还需要有强大的建模和网格划分工具。 1.1 FLAC3D与MIDASGTS软件的特点 FLAC3D有限差分程序是基于岩土类介质开发的国际著名数值计算软件之一,该程序能较好地模拟岩土类材料在达到强度极限或屈服时发生的破坏或塑性流动的力学行为,特别适用于分析渐进破坏、失稳以及模拟大变形现象。然而,由于FLAC3D面向比较复杂的三维工程建模以及单元网格划分等前处理问题上存在诸多技术困难,致使建模过程繁琐、工作量大、花费时间长,导致了FLAC3D处理三维复杂工程模型问题的难度加大。随着FLAC3D在岩土工程领域应用的不断拓展和深入,其在三维复杂工程建模方面呈现的问题逐渐凸显出来。 MIDAS/GTS是韩国开发的岩土与隧道结构有限元分析软件,该软件的几何建模和网格划分功能十分强大,主要体现在以下2个方面:(1)几何建模功能。MIDAS/GTS有Windows窗口式的操作界面,通过点取菜单完成操作,可以方便地建立各种点、线、面、体,并可进行布尔运算、复制、旋转、嵌入、分割等操作;可以导入后缀为.DXF等格式文件,实现与AutoCAD等软件的数据交换;其内置的地形数据生成器,可以利用导入的.DXF格式的地形等高线方便地生成复杂曲面。(2)网格划分功能。MIDAS/GTS除了可以较快地划分映射网格和自由网格以外,还可以根据用户设定的种子数量和种子分布自动划分四边形为主(平面单元)或六面体为主(三维单元)的网格,且网格质量较高。网格划分后,还可以对网格进行析取、检查、手动分割等网格调整操作,对复杂模型网格划分与检查十分方便。 FLAC3D软件的计算求解和后处理功能强大,但前处理功能(几何建模、网格划分)不足;MIDAS GTS软件的前处理功能(几何建模、网格划分)强大,而本构模型、计算求解功能不足,如果能够将两者结合起来,充分发挥各自的优势,无疑将能够大幅提高隧道与地下工程数值建模分析的工作效率。 2. 技术原理及性能指标 将FLAC3D与MIDAS GTS软件结合的方式主要通过在MIDAS GTS软件中完成几何建模和网格划分后,导出为适用于FLAC3D的网格文件,以供FLAC3D计算求解使用。然而,MIDAS GTS软件自身不支持这一功能,因此需要研究这两个软件的特点,开发相应的网格数据转换软件工具来实现这一功能。本软件的开发环境与编程语言:(1)操作系统:Windows 10;(2)开发环境:Visual Studio Community 2017;(3)编程语言:C# 7.0。 3. 技术的创造性与先进性 本软件主要的功能为:解析MIDAS GTS生成的离散数值网格的节点和单元信息,生成FLAC3D 6.0软件建模所需要的所有节点和单元信息。本软件的主要特色有:(1)功能完备,支持最新标准。支持FLAC3D软件数值分析所需要的所有类型的单元,包括三维实体单元(zone)、二维平面单元(face图元)和一维线性单元(edge图元),而且所输出的FLAC3D网格文件和GEOM几何图形信息文件的格式符合最新版本的FLAC3D 6.0的标准;(2)用户界面友好,操作简便。提供简洁直观的Windows图形用户界面,仅需简单的几步鼠标点击操作即可完成网格数据的转换工作,且实时给出当前转换进度;(3)运行速度快捷,界面响应迅速。本软件采用C# 7.0语言编写,转换算法经过优化,使得转换速度相当快捷;对于耗时的转换过程采用多线程技术,使得及时对于数十万单元规模的大型数值模型,用户界面都能迅速响应,并及时提示当前转换进度,而不会出现界面卡顿。 (不少于500字,不超过2000字)
1. 课题的研究来源与背景 工程力学数值分析是隧道与地下工程研究领域的主要研究手段。在数值分析中,一个重要的步骤和先决条件是形成合理的离散网格模型。所谓合理的网格模型,即要求数值网格满足以下条件:(1)尽可能少的节点数与单元数;(2)合理的网格疏密分布;(3)合理的单元几何形状。显然,对于面向实际工程的数值网格模型,要满足以上三个条件,除了数值建模人员需要有足够的网格划分经验和技巧外,还需要有强大的建模和网格划分工具。 1.1 FLAC3D与MIDASGTS软件的特点 FLAC3D有限差分程序是基于岩土类介质开发的国际著名数值计算软件之一,该程序能较好地模拟岩土类材料在达到强度极限或屈服时发生的破坏或塑性流动的力学行为,特别适用于分析渐进破坏、失稳以及模拟大变形现象。然而,由于FLAC3D面向比较复杂的三维工程建模以及单元网格划分等前处理问题上存在诸多技术困难,致使建模过程繁琐、工作量大、花费时间长,导致了FLAC3D处理三维复杂工程模型问题的难度加大。随着FLAC3D在岩土工程领域应用的不断拓展和深入,其在三维复杂工程建模方面呈现的问题逐渐凸显出来。 MIDAS/GTS是韩国开发的岩土与隧道结构有限元分析软件,该软件的几何建模和网格划分功能十分强大,主要体现在以下2个方面:(1)几何建模功能。MIDAS/GTS有Windows窗口式的操作界面,通过点取菜单完成操作,可以方便地建立各种点、线、面、体,并可进行布尔运算、复制、旋转、嵌入、分割等操作;可以导入后缀为.DXF等格式文件,实现与AutoCAD等软件的数据交换;其内置的地形数据生成器,可以利用导入的.DXF格式的地形等高线方便地生成复杂曲面。(2)网格划分功能。MIDAS/GTS除了可以较快地划分映射网格和自由网格以外,还可以根据用户设定的种子数量和种子分布自动划分四边形为主(平面单元)或六面体为主(三维单元)的网格,且网格质量较高。网格划分后,还可以对网格进行析取、检查、手动分割等网格调整操作,对复杂模型网格划分与检查十分方便。 FLAC3D软件的计算求解和后处理功能强大,但前处理功能(几何建模、网格划分)不足;MIDAS GTS软件的前处理功能(几何建模、网格划分)强大,而本构模型、计算求解功能不足,如果能够将两者结合起来,充分发挥各自的优势,无疑将能够大幅提高隧道与地下工程数值建模分析的工作效率。 2. 技术原理及性能指标 将FLAC3D与MIDAS GTS软件结合的方式主要通过在MIDAS GTS软件中完成几何建模和网格划分后,导出为适用于FLAC3D的网格文件,以供FLAC3D计算求解使用。然而,MIDAS GTS软件自身不支持这一功能,因此需要研究这两个软件的特点,开发相应的网格数据转换软件工具来实现这一功能。本软件的开发环境与编程语言:(1)操作系统:Windows 10;(2)开发环境:Visual Studio Community 2017;(3)编程语言:C# 7.0。 3. 技术的创造性与先进性 本软件主要的功能为:解析MIDAS GTS生成的离散数值网格的节点和单元信息,生成FLAC3D 6.0软件建模所需要的所有节点和单元信息。本软件的主要特色有:(1)功能完备,支持最新标准。支持FLAC3D软件数值分析所需要的所有类型的单元,包括三维实体单元(zone)、二维平面单元(face图元)和一维线性单元(edge图元),而且所输出的FLAC3D网格文件和GEOM几何图形信息文件的格式符合最新版本的FLAC3D 6.0的标准;(2)用户界面友好,操作简便。提供简洁直观的Windows图形用户界面,仅需简单的几步鼠标点击操作即可完成网格数据的转换工作,且实时给出当前转换进度;(3)运行速度快捷,界面响应迅速。本软件采用C# 7.0语言编写,转换算法经过优化,使得转换速度相当快捷;对于耗时的转换过程采用多线程技术,使得及时对于数十万单元规模的大型数值模型,用户界面都能迅速响应,并及时提示当前转换进度,而不会出现界面卡顿。 (不少于500字,不超过2000字)

推荐服务:

Copyright © 2015 科易网 版权所有 闽ICP备07063032号-5